1) Generating Power in the Golf Swing

This talk is focused on the Biomechanics of the Big Hitters, discussing the key Biomechanics that are linked to the generation of clubhead speed. As part of this discussion, we will also highlight the differences that exist between higher skilled and less skilled golfers, as well as showing how such variables can be analysed using 3D motion capture and force plates.

​

We start off the talk by dicussing the importance of distance, exploring PGA tour data and research, as well as, discussing the key determinants of driving distance.

 

We then shift the focus onto the biomechanics that are linked to the generation of clubhead speed. Discussing X-Factor, X-Factor Stretch, Timing of Wrist Break, Timing of Max Clubhead SpeedGround Reaction Forces and Kinematic Sequencing.

2) The Biomechanics of Golfing Injuries I 

This talk is focused on the biomechanics of the most prevalent golfing injury; this being Lower Back Pain. We will highlight the key movements in the golf swing that can increase injury risk and identify posture/swing changes that could potentially mitigate this risk. Furthermore, we will also explain why certain movements can cause damage to the lower back, looking at the anatomy of the spine to help with this explanation.

​

We start the talk by discussing the statistics of golfing injuries, identifying the areas of the body that experience the most injuries, as well as highlighting how the injury occurrence differs depending on the skill level and gender of the golfer. 

 

We then shift the focus onto lower back pain, looking at the anatomy of the injured site, explaining what movements can cause damage, as well as discussing the key movements in the golf swing that can increase the risk of injury.
